From a Mumbai chawl to Vienna via Westminster
Three years ago, in 2008 to be precise, a Mumbai girl called Varalaxmi Pillai, daughter of a domestic help, won the Sheriff's Scholarship for Women to the University of Westminster, London. Today, this woman who spent her childhood in a 150-sq foot house in the central Mumbai suburb and is still living there with a limited supply of water and electricity, has returned, this time armed with a Master's Degree in International Business and Management.
